The Budget Maintenance Protocol
Natural fibers are alive. They don't like harsh chemicals or industrial heat.
If you spend 5 minutes on care, you save months of replacement costs.
The Gold Rules of Care
1. The Cold Wash
Heat is the enemy of budget threads. It breaks down the structure and fades the print.
Always use cold water.
2. Gentle Detergents
Avoid "Bleach-Active" soaps. They eat the color for breakfast.
3. Turning Inside Out
Protects the surface of the fabric and the vibrancy of the print from the machine drum.

Storage Secrets
- Ensure Bone-Dry: Never store cotton while damp; it will develop mildew.
- Wooden Hangers: Prevent the 'pucks' in the shoulders.
- Natural Repellents: Use neem leaves or lavender in the drawer.
FAQs
Q: Can I use a dryer? A: NO. High heat causes 5% shrinkage and makes the fibers brittle. Air dry is mandatory.
Q: How do I handle stains? A: Cold water and mild soap immediately. Blot, don't rub.
Q: Do I need to starch daily wear? A: Only if you want a professional, crisp look. For home, let it be soft.
Q: Best iron setting? A: Cotton setting with steam. Iron while slightly damp.
